Understanding Hair Loss

Before diving into the specifics of shampoos and their impact on hair loss, it’s essential to understand the basics of hair loss. Hair loss, or alopecia, can be temporary or permanent, depending on its cause. Common causes include androgenetic alopecia (male/female pattern baldness), alopecia areata (an autoimmune condition), and telogen effluvium (stress-induced hair loss). The way you care for your hair, including the shampoo you use, can influence the health and integrity of your hair, potentially leading to hair loss if not done correctly.

Role of Shampoos in Hair Care

Shampoos play a critical role in hair care, serving to cleanse the hair and scalp of dirt, oil, and other impurities. However, not all shampoos are created equal. The formulation of a shampoo can significantly impact its effectiveness and safety for your hair. Ingredients such as sulfates, parabens, and silicones are commonly found in many commercial shampoos. While these ingredients can provide benefits such as rich lather and moisturization, they can also strip the hair of its natural oils, cause buildup, and irritate the scalp, potentially contributing to hair loss.

Shampoos That Do Not Make Hair Fall Out

Given the numerous shampoo options available, identifying those that do not contribute to hair fall can be overwhelming. The key is to look for shampoos that are formulated with hair growth in mind, using ingredients that promote healthy hair and scalp conditions. Some of the best shampoos for preventing hair loss include those with:

  • Biotin: Known for its ability to strengthen hair follicles and promote hair growth.
  • Keratin: Helps in repairing and protecting hair from damage, reducing breakage.
  • Saw Palmetto: Believed to block the conversion of testosterone to dihydrotestosterone (DHT), a hormone linked to hair loss.
  • Rosemary Essential Oil: Can improve circulation to the scalp, promoting healthy hair growth.

Choosing the Right Shampoo for Your Hair Type

The effectiveness of a shampoo in preventing hair loss also depends on its suitability for your hair type. For example, individuals with dry or damaged hair may benefit from a moisturizing shampoo that is rich in nourishing ingredients but gentle enough not to strip the hair of its natural oils. On the other hand, those with oily hair may prefer a lightweight, oil-control shampoo that helps manage sebum production without drying out the hair.

Are there any specific shampoo ingredients that can exacerbate hair loss?

Yes, there are several shampoo ingredients that can exacerbate hair loss, including sulfates, parabens, and silicones. Sulfates, such as sodium lauryl sulfate, can strip the hair of its natural oils, leading to dryness, brittleness, and breakage. Parabens, such as methylparaben and propylparaben, have been linked to hormone disruption and can contribute to hair loss. Silicones, such as dimethicone and cyclomethicone, can weigh the hair down and cause buildup, leading to dryness and breakage.

To avoid exacerbating hair loss, look for a shampoo that is sulfate-free, paraben-free, and silicone-free. Instead, opt for a shampoo that is formulated with gentle, natural ingredients that nourish and moisturize the hair and scalp. Consider a shampoo that contains ingredients such as coconut oil, shea butter, and argan oil, which can help to moisturize and protect the hair.
